I really was going to answer all these questions because I’m done with people just not knowing Spanish history yet feeling entitled to make all kind of fantastic asumptions based on 16th century Protestan anti-Spanish propaganda and 19th century dumb racial theories. Worst is, they don’t even know where their stupid assumptions are really comming from and they trully believe this was all down to Europeans being shocked at Spaniards’ brutallity, instead of what it really was about, Europeans being shocked at Spaniards’ willingness to mix and coexist with Native Americans, and to a lesser extent, with Jews and Muslims. And I know I said this many times, but I really invite everyone to read 19th century racial theories and what those people thought of the “Spanish race” (raza Hispana), Spaniards, and Native Americans. You may learn where the (in)famous term “Latino” came from as well. A clue, it is not nice.

So I will say just one thing. Look up LAS LEYES DE INDIAS. Do it. And then think about any other country, nation, human group, whatever, that has anything similar to the Spanish legislation of Las Leyes de Indias.
